What sets Alpha Progression apart is its sophisticated approach to progressive overload. The app analyzes your performance in past sessions and provides precise recommendations for weight and rep targets in every single set. This ensures you’re always progressing optimally without the guesswork that plagues most gym-goers.

Daily Workouts – Home Trainer is a free home workout app with plenty of variety for users of all fitness levels. Daily Workouts stands out from other apps thanks to its large selection of targeted exercises, allowing users to choose exercises focused on a specific muscle group. The app’s workout classes range from five to 30 minutes, and each exercise is accompanied by a video to demonstrate form. Daily Workouts also includes on-screen instructions and timers, and most of the app’s workouts and exercises are available offline, so you can take your workout anywhere.
